ADHD and coding? by frendlyfrens in Unity3D

[–]debuggingmyhead 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I would also highly recommend breaking down your game dev work into the smallest possible tasks and create to-do lists (I use paper ones myself as I find physically checking off the boxes is incredibly satisfying mentally).

I will sometimes also just carve out time to plan out my to-do lists and make the lists (which I guess is technically project management).

Then I find it "easy" to just sit down, look at the next immediate task on my current to-do, and do it without my focus wandering. The key is having very small and very focused tasks on the list (e.g. have a task for "implement forward movement on Enemy X" instead of "implement multi-directional movement logic for all enemies").

At least for me, without that to-do list structure I endlessly procrastinate or focus shift because I'm trying to pin down nebulous goals to work on.
